Data Presentation

An automobile, auto car, motor car or car is a wheeled motor vehicle used for transporting passengers, which also carries its own engine or motor. Objective of this data presentation is to analyze, interpret and present the data regarding to the mean, standard deviation, minimum and maximum of different variables that affect in the automobiles released in 1978. The data presented by table, graph and a pie chart. This study entails about 74 car models of automobile in 1978.

Table 1 showed the summary of descriptive statistics. That illustrates the different variables such as price, mileage (mpg), repair record 1978, headroom, trunk space, weight, length, turn, displacement and gear ratio that will affect in the decision of the buyers in acquire automobiles.

In the year 1978 the automobiles price or average mean is $6165.26 that ranges from $3291 to $15906. It varying a high standard deviation of price which is 2949.50 that indicates the data points are spread out over a large range of price.

It can be seen on the table below that the mileage of each model is also observed. The automobiles can run an average mileage of 21.30 mpg (miles per gallon). The standard deviation is low as 5.79. Automobiles approximately can run at least 12 mpg (miles per gallon) up to 41 (mpg) miles per gallon by most efficient fuel.

During the year 1978 the repair record of 74 automobiles is also indicated. It sheen on the table below a record of automobiles had repaired at highest rate of 5 times and lowest of once. The average times of each model are 3.41 times of being repaired while it had low standard deviation of .99.
